Non-Surgical Spinal Decompression in Glenwood Springs
If you’re dealing with a herniated or bulging disc, sciatica, or degenerative disc disease, spinal decompression is a conservative option designed to relieve pressure on irritated discs and nerves. We pair decompression with targeted rehab and chiropractic care so relief turns into durable results.

Not every case is appropriate for decompression. We’ll screen you first and explain the best options for your specific condition.
Great for many disc-related conditions. Decompression may not be appropriate with recent fractures, severe osteoporosis, certain post-surgical hardware, active spinal infection, or pregnancy. We’ll review your history carefully and guide you to the safest, most effective plan.
